This role sits within our Global Master Data Management (MDM) team (part of the Data Office), whose primary focus is to ensure the organization's data assets are effectively managed, governed, and utilized to support strategic decision-making and operational excellence. As the Functional Data Specialist, you will support the management, maintenance, and governance of master data across various systems and departments within the organization. This role ensures the quality and accuracy of master data, assists in data integration efforts, and contributes directly to data governance initiatives. ****What you will be responsible for:**** ****Data Maintenance:** **Assist in the creation, update, and deletion of master data in relevant systems. Ensure the accuracy, consistency, and completeness of master data records while performing regular data quality checks and audits. ****Data Governance:**** Adhere to and support the implementation of data governance policies and procedures. Help to document and maintain data standards, definitions, and guidelines across multiple data domains (e.g., suppliers, materials, finance). ****Data Quality:**** Conduct routine data quality assessments, identify data discrepancies, and support data cleansing and enrichment activities. Assist in the resolution of data quality issues and root cause analysis. ****Data Analysis:** **Support data analysis initiatives to drive business insights and decisions. How to Apply on Workday
- Workday has a multi-step form — save your progress after every section.
- "Apply With LinkedIn" can fail or lose data; manual entry is more reliable.
- Watch for the "Submit for Review" final step — hitting "Save" alone does not submit.
- Job requisition numbers are useful when following up with HR by email.
